In 2018 AM Automatic Machines implemented Zucchetti Mago4 ERP as its core ERP Financial application to support order-to-manufacture workflows for a specialized vending machine manufacturer. The deployment targeted highly configurable product records to capture optional extras and multi-configuration sales orders, addressing the sales function requirement to enter complete orders without deep technical intervention. The implementation emphasized Mago4 modules for order management with a product configurator, production management and outsourcing controls, and MRP-driven purchasing planning. AM also configured deferred invoicing workflows and extensive document management using EasyAttachment, enabling automated archiving of system-generated documents and barcode-based scanning for accounts payable. Architecturally the solution leveraged Mago4 web services and a .net based development stack, providing an open integration layer to connect Mago4 ERP Financial with peripheral systems and document repositories. EasyAttachment was integrated to store documents produced by Zucchetti Mago4 ERP and to associate scanned invoices and order documents with items and transactions, extending operational coverage across sales, production, purchasing and accounts payable. Giga Working Partners served as the system integrator and consultant for configuration, customization and operator training, focusing on tailoring the configurator rules and MRP parameters to AMs component lead times. Governance activity included partner-led training for nontechnical operators and on-site knowledge transfer to IT staff, enabling process ownership for order entry, purchasing scheduling and outsourced production coordination. According to AMs IT management, Zucchetti Mago4 ERP met the stated business needs, delivering a configurable order entry experience, calibrated MRP functionality for long lead items, and powerful automatic document procedures through EasyAttachment. The team highlighted the openness of web services and the user friendliness of the .net based interface, and credited Giga Working Partners for enabling customization and operational adoption.

AM Automatic Machines is a Manufacturing organization based in Italy, with around 88 employees and annual revenues of $28.0 million.
AM Automatic Machines operates a diverse technology stack with applications such as Zucchetti Mago4 ERP, Google Workspace (Formerly Google G-Suite) and WordPress, covering areas like ERP Financial, Collaboration and Web Content Management.
AM Automatic Machines has invested in cloud applications and AI-driven platforms to optimize efficiency and growth, collaborating with vendors such as Zucchetti, Google and Automattic.
AM Automatic Machines recently adopted applications including Contentful Content Platform in 2025, Cloudflare Workers in 2025 and Cloudflare CDN in 2025, highlighting its ongoing modernization strategy.
